Victoria Blachly, a partner with Portland law firm Samuels Yoelin Kantor LLP, has been appointed by Oregon Gov. Kate Brown to a four-year term on the Commission on Uniform State Laws. It’s Oregon’s branch of the Uniform Law Commission, a national nonprofit that provides states with nonpartisan, well-conceived and well-drafted legislation to bring clarity and stability to critical areas of state statutory law. As one of Oregon’s three commissioners, Blachly will represent the state at national conferences, help research and draft state laws, and appear before legislators to explain and promote the passage of those laws. Blachly is a fiduciary litigator and trial attorney. She represents individual and corporate trustees, beneficiaries and personal representatives.
